When taking your senior pictures, it is normal to want to bring people along. There are plenty of people you could bring and the day with people makes the day so much better! Whoever you choose to bring, be sure you let them know ahead of time what you need during the day. It’s also good to remember that sometimes, too many people is… well… too many. Be sure you think about who makes you comfortable  and think about who you truly want with you. In the end, it's entirely up to you who you would like to bring with you. However, here are some suggestions to consider…

1. Friends: Having a loving and trusted friend come to your senior pictures is a great way to help you feel confident and relaxed. Bringing a friend along is also a great way for you to have a very memorable experience. Your senior pictures are a once in a lifetime experience so why not share it with someone special like a friend. Sometimes, our friends are the closest people to us and in that moment of our lives, it’s so rewarding and meaningful to have our chosen family with us. Plus, you’ll have beautiful pictures to remember this time with your friends that you’ll have forever. What’s better?

2. Pets: If you have a furry friend that you adore, consider bringing them along for some pictures. Pets can add a fun and unique element to your photos. Plus, why wouldn’t you want to bring your fur babies with you? They can help you stay calm and relaxed and the best part, you’ll get amazing pictures with the pets you love most. Most places in Colorado is dog friendly which makes pet pictures even easier. Are you a cat lover? Bring your kitty if you want! Have a horse that you love more than anything? Let’s go out and get pictures with your horse. Whatever pet you want to take pictures with let’s get those pictures taken. You won’t regret having your pet come with you! Trust me.

3. Family: ​The most common people that come to senior pictures is family. Moms, dads, siblings, grandparents. All of these people want to share in the day with you and they are great people to have around that day. They know you the best and they know how to make you smile. Your family is obviously so proud of your achievements so let them be with you during this big day. While they’re there, we’ll be sure to snap a few pictures with your family member. What a great and meaningful way to remember that moment and have these beautiful pictures forever. 
No matter who you choose to bring to your senior pictures, or don’t choose, the choice is yours. Who do you want with you during your pictures? Who makes you feel happy? Confident? Relaxed?
